Orig 914/6 transaxle was howling on acceleration. It was most noticable on light acceleration and around 2500-3000RPM. Oil level was full.

I removed the trans during the resto, and I'm converting to side-shift. Looking inside, I don't see any noticeable Ring & Pinion wear, but I could be overlooking something. Carrier Bearings look slightly dull in the race, but not pitted.

I don't see any adjustment for the Ring & Pinion except for the shim under the 1st Gear Set. I also noticed that there were 3 paper gaskets between the Intermediate Plate and the Main Housing; does anyone know if that could cause a Howling Noise?

My questions are:
1. Does howling on acceleration mean Ring & Pinion noise?
2. Can the Ring & Pinion be adjusted?
3. Why would someone use 3 paper gaskets?
4. What would noisy Ring & Pinion wear look like?
